## 4.2.0 — Renamed setting

Coldvault's archiver option ARCHIVE_BUCKET_KEY is now COLDVAULT_ARCHIVE_TOKEN to match the new naming scheme. The old name is ignored as of this release; the archiver will refuse to start if only the legacy key is present. Update every `.env` on the Frostline archive hosts before deploying. The env file should define the token on the following line.

sealed setting: ARCHIVE_KEY3=8d0

## Deploy Step 4 — Role-Based Access, Quillpad Wiki

Apply the RBAC migration before restarting the Quillpad service. Roles are defined in `roles.yaml`; reviewers should confirm that `editor` no longer inherits `admin`. Verify RBAC_ENFORCE=strict in the env file — permissive mode is for local dev only. After the migration, the role-cache service must re-authenticate to the directory backend. The credential it uses for that handshake is set on the next line of the env file.

vault entry, yahaf-tagug: LEDGER_TOKEN20=884d77d1a8b98aa4edfb

**Handover: orphaned-resource sweeper**

Taking over Gleanly from me. It sweeps unattached volumes and dangling DNS records nightly. Plugin authors: your cleanup hooks run after the dry-run pass, never before. Respect the grace-period flag or you'll delete things customers still want. Open item: the tagging plugin double-counts in region pairs. Current sweeper configuration that plugins can read at startup follows.

service settings:
[casax]
port = 6379
team = rusir
host = casax.zemvarhq.corp
region = outer-4
access_code = ac_9808ce
timeout_ms = 1500

# Schema registry configuration for the Wrenfold event pipeline.
# Every event published to the Hollowmere bus must reference a schema
# registered here; unregistered payloads are rejected at the producer.
# New team members: never edit schemas in place — bump the version and
# let compatibility checks run. The registry persists schema versions
# in its own database, configured with the connection string below.

replica DSN, kajep-yahag: mssql://praok_svc:iF@db-8d68.plorvaio.local:5432/eliion